French talisman Dupont says he was not put under pressure to return against SA

France captain Antoine Dupont said yesterday that the French coaching staff did not pressure him to play in this weekend’s Rugby World Cup quarter-final against defending champions South Africa.

The 26-year-old scrumhalf underwent surgery on a fractured cheekbone – which he suffered in the September 21 win over Namibia – three weeks ago.

Dupont, who only returned to full contact training this week, will wear a scrum cap, as demanded by his surgeon.
